    Slow cooker chicken (aka honey mustard chicken)
    Prep time: 5 minutes Cooking time: Low 6-7 hours Ingredients:
    2 lbs boneless skinless chicken thighs or breasts
    3/4 cup mustard
    1/2 cup honey
    Directions:
    1. Put chicken in slow cooker
    2. Combine mustard and honey, pour over chicken
    3. Cook on low 6-7 hours or high 3-4 hours Optimal result is low 6-7 with chicken thighs. Usually we'd double or triple the recipe to have enough leftovers for 2-3 days.

    Slow cooker sloppy joe
    3 lb ground beef 1 onion (chopped)
    2 cups BBQ or Ketchup
    1 cup mustard
    1/2 cup Worcestershire sauce (or any kind of steak sauce or soy sauce if you're using BBQ) Directions:
    1. In large skillet, brown ground beef and onion. Drain the fat/oil, put into slow cooker.
    2. Put the rest of the ingredients into slow cooker.
    3. Cook on low 5-6 hours or high 2-3 hours.
